Transaction 44e26ab542f6457bfd56b6c1834bf478551d2e9e9e23d97b461704865214af78

1 Input
2 Outputs
  • 44e26ab542f6457bfd56b6c1834bf478551d2e9e9e23d97b461704865214af78:0
  • value  1320000
    address  34kGR9KtDScBoQ4wAm2vkodRY2PJ5rjFKn
  • 44e26ab542f6457bfd56b6c1834bf478551d2e9e9e23d97b461704865214af78:1
  • value  45777188
    address  3MX6fX3AtiqduG11YXvgqAzFuHea7RBRNW